In more detail

Grab a seat along Naples’ waterfront and dive into classic pies with a view of the bay. The room is warm and bustling, often with a line at the door and servers hustling plates to sunlit tables. One diner summed it up: "We ate outside in the sun, sipped spritzes, and watched the sea." However, expect crowd energy and the occasional hiccup—some report long queues and rare service lapses. The cooking leans traditional Neapolitan with creative twists: stuffed cornicione, ragù-laced specials, and pistachio-mortadella combinations sit alongside textbook Margherita and Marinara. When the oven is in rhythm the pizzas sing—sweet tomato, soft cornicione, and generous toppings—though peak rush can bring inconsistency with the odd cold or soggy pie. Families do well here thanks to familiar options like Margherita and Cotoletta, fries, and simple salads. Vegan choices are unusually strong, and gluten-free bases are available, though quality varies. It is lively and crowded at peak, so early meals or off-hours are best for kids.

Location Insights

Area vibe: Lively seafront promenade popular with locals and visitors; scenic bay views and heavy foot traffic.

Safety: Generally safe, well-patrolled waterfront with strong pedestrian presence, especially evenings and weekends.

What's nearby: Opposite the bay near Castel dell’Ovo; hotels, cafes, and gelaterie line the promenade.
